Output 1717daa3450e2176fb6c90982f2ed236c5bbe8f708a83ef58dcf542a470910a5:0

value
260108889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b6ebdc474f3cf1515ce99ad9e9e7893e5b0ea5 OP_EQUAL
address
3FA4PLepBVRdzurJfrYEhFeJKy9yrd9h7c
transaction
1717daa3450e2176fb6c90982f2ed236c5bbe8f708a83ef58dcf542a470910a5
confirmations
360705
spent
true